Bechem United forward, Abednego Tetteh has taken a swipe at the Ghana Football Association’s official website for reducing his goal tally for the 2015/2016 Ghana Premier League season from 14 to 10.
In a rather sarcastic Facebook postponed , the highly rated goal poacher pleaded with his fans and friends to tell the Website administrators the actual number of goals he has to his credit before stating his impressive numbers in all competitions.
“Please can someone tell the GFA website that my goals are not 10 but 14 and 3 goals in the FA CUP which is 17goals a season wai thanks”, Tetteh wrote on his Facebook timeline on Tuesday night.
Tetteh was instrumental for Bechem United in the second round of the Ghanaian top flight, helping his side lift the MTN FA Cup trophy.
His form for the Brong Ahafo based club also earn him a call up to the Black Stars for the AFCON 2017 qualifier against Rwanda last month.
However, the powerful forward did not feature in the game after Bechem United trainer Manuel Zachariah named him in his squad for the Cup final which was played a day after the qualifier.
